Mold growing in my Biodome, help.

I ordered a biodome from parkseeds, and I put seeds and cuttings in it a few days ago.

This morning I noticed a few of the cells have grown fuzzy mold.

I am worried about the rest of my seedlings.


Is there something I can do to get rid of the mold without hurting the plants?

The mold is on the tray with my cuttings, not the tray with the seedlings.

Leave it open so it can dry out and mist less often. You can also use some hydrogen peroxide in your mister to control any mold.
